KPI's

38.74 PFlop/s RPEAK Overall computing power
144 Compute nodes
85,248 CPU cores
110 TByte Total memory
Rank 51 Top500 (Nov 2024)
Rank 5 Green500 (Nov 2024)

MEGWARE and TU Dresden have created Capella that not only sets new standards in computational power, but also opens up new horizons  
in terms of energy efficiency. The aim was  to create a balance between extreme  computational power and maximum energy  efficiency – without compromising on  scalability.
Capella‘s computing nodes are based on state-of-the-art Lenovo servers, which have been specially designed for maximum efficiency and performance in the HPC sector. Each of the more than 140 nodes is equipped with four NVIDIA H100 accelerators and two AMD processors with 32 cores each. This combination enables an impressive peak computing performance of over 38 petaflops.
